Mori Collective: Street wear does Sustainable Style

Finland-based Mori Collective is bringing street wear with a sustainable flair to the urban market. Mori Collective, which consists of two labels Mori & Diamonds From Dirt, has recently launched its 2016 Forever Seasons Collection. Elvis & Kresse: Reporter bag

Elvis & Kresse Reporter Bags made from fire hoses Travel light daily with this reporter bag from Elvis & Kresse, which has just enough space to carry your key essentials.
